Calling all Career Changers! Volunteers Needed to Relaunch the Elizabeth M. Mauro Reimbursement Program

The CAS is seeking volunteers who identify as career changers to support the relaunch of the Actuary – A Career Change: Elizabeth M. Mauro Reimbursement Program. This program, formerly administered by the Actuarial Foundation and being relaunched by the CAS in 2025, provides aspiring career changers with financial support for actuarial exams. Awardees are also assigned a mentor to provide advice and guidance on their path to finding employment in an actuarial role.
